Rio Project 4.2 API Documentation
org.rioproject.resolver.maven2
Class PomParser
java.lang.Object
org.rioproject.resolver.maven2.PomParser
- All Implemented Interfaces:
- groovy.lang.GroovyObject
public class PomParser
- extends Object
- implements groovy.lang.GroovyObject
|
Method Summary |
protected groovy.lang.MetaClass |
$getStaticMetaClass()
|
ArtifactUtils |
getArtifactUtils()
|
boolean |
getBuildFromProject()
|
Object |
getDepManagement()
|
Object |
getExcludes()
|
Object |
getLocalRepository()
|
Logger |
getLogger()
|
groovy.lang.MetaClass |
getMetaClass()
|
Object |
getProcessedDeps()
|
Object |
getProcessedPoms()
|
Map<String,File> |
getProjectModuleMap()
|
Object |
getProperties()
|
Object |
getProperty(String property)
|
Object |
getRemoteRepositories()
|
Object |
getResolvedParents()
|
Settings |
getSettings()
|
Object |
invokeMethod(String method,
Object arguments)
|
boolean |
isBuildFromProject()
|
ResolutionResult |
parse(Artifact artifact,
URL u,
DependencyFilter filter)
|
Object |
parse(Dependency dep,
DependencyFilter filter)
|
Object |
processParent(Object pom,
Artifact a,
DependencyFilter filter,
URL u,
ResolutionResult r)
|
void |
setArtifactUtils(ArtifactUtils value)
|
void |
setBuildFromProject(boolean value)
|
void |
setDepManagement(Object value)
|
void |
setExcludes(Object value)
|
void |
setLocalRepository(Object value)
|
void |
setLogger(Logger value)
|
void |
setMetaClass(groovy.lang.MetaClass mc)
|
void |
setProcessedDeps(Object value)
|
void |
setProcessedPoms(Object value)
|
void |
setProjectModuleMap(Map<String,File> value)
|
void |
setProperties(Object value)
|
void |
setProperty(String property,
Object value)
|
void |
setRemoteRepositories(Object value)
|
void |
setResolvedParents(Object value)
|
void |
setSettings(Settings value)
|
|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
PomParser
public PomParser()
getMetaClass
public groovy.lang.MetaClass getMetaClass()
- Specified by:
getMetaClass in interface groovy.lang.GroovyObject
setMetaClass
public void setMetaClass(groovy.lang.MetaClass mc)
- Specified by:
setMetaClass in interface groovy.lang.GroovyObject
invokeMethod
public Object invokeMethod(String method,
Object arguments)
- Specified by:
invokeMethod in interface groovy.lang.GroovyObject
getProperty
public Object getProperty(String property)
- Specified by:
getProperty in interface groovy.lang.GroovyObject
setProperty
public void setProperty(String property,
Object value)
- Specified by:
setProperty in interface groovy.lang.GroovyObject
getSettings
public Settings getSettings()
setSettings
public void setSettings(Settings value)
getRemoteRepositories
public Object getRemoteRepositories()
setRemoteRepositories
public void setRemoteRepositories(Object value)
getLocalRepository
public Object getLocalRepository()
setLocalRepository
public void setLocalRepository(Object value)
getDepManagement
public Object getDepManagement()
setDepManagement
public void setDepManagement(Object value)
getProcessedDeps
public Object getProcessedDeps()
setProcessedDeps
public void setProcessedDeps(Object value)
getProcessedPoms
public Object getProcessedPoms()
setProcessedPoms
public void setProcessedPoms(Object value)
getResolvedParents
public Object getResolvedParents()
setResolvedParents
public void setResolvedParents(Object value)
getProperties
public Object getProperties()
setProperties
public void setProperties(Object value)
getArtifactUtils
public ArtifactUtils getArtifactUtils()
setArtifactUtils
public void setArtifactUtils(ArtifactUtils value)
getExcludes
public Object getExcludes()
setExcludes
public void setExcludes(Object value)
getBuildFromProject
public boolean getBuildFromProject()
isBuildFromProject
public boolean isBuildFromProject()
setBuildFromProject
public void setBuildFromProject(boolean value)
getProjectModuleMap
public Map<String,File> getProjectModuleMap()
setProjectModuleMap
public void setProjectModuleMap(Map<String,File> value)
getLogger
public Logger getLogger()
setLogger
public void setLogger(Logger value)
parse
public Object parse(Dependency dep,
DependencyFilter filter)
parse
public ResolutionResult parse(Artifact artifact,
URL u,
DependencyFilter filter)
processParent
public Object processParent(Object pom,
Artifact a,
DependencyFilter filter,
URL u,
ResolutionResult r)
$getStaticMetaClass
protected groovy.lang.MetaClass $getStaticMetaClass()
Copyright © 2006-2011 Rio Project. All Rights Reserved.